Product description

Immerse yourself in the rich musical legacy of John Philip Sousa with "The Heritage of John Philip Sousa, Vol. 7," a captivating collection of marches and compositions that showcase the brilliance of this American bandmaster and composer. Released on September 6, 2011, under The Robert Hoe Collection, this album spans a generous 82 minutes, offering a comprehensive journey through Sousa's timeless works.

The album opens with the evocative "Looking Upward" suite, followed by a medley of Sousa's patriotic and lively compositions. From the energetic "Marching Through Georgia" to the charming "Bonnie Annie Laurie," each track is a testament to Sousa's ability to blend melody, rhythm, and emotion. The album also features notable arrangements by Sousa himself and other esteemed arrangers, adding depth and variety to the listening experience.

Fans of classic marches will delight in tracks like "The Diplomat," "Esprit de Corps," and "The Liberty Bell," while those new to Sousa's music will find themselves drawn into the vibrant and dynamic world of early 20th-century American music. Whether you're a seasoned enthusiast or a curious newcomer, "The Heritage of John Philip Sousa, Vol. 7" is a treasure trove of musical excellence that highlights the enduring appeal of Sousa's compositions.

About John Philip Sousa

John Philip Sousa, the legendary 'March King', was an American composer and conductor who left an indelible mark on the late Romantic era with his stirring military and patriotic marches. Born in 1854, Sousa's compositions, such as 'The Stars and Stripes Forever', 'Semper Fidelis', and 'The Washington Post', have become synonymous with American pride and are still performed and beloved today. Sousa's career spanned continents, with his band touring both America and Europe, including prestigious performances in Vienna. His prolific output includes over 100 marches and several operettas, showcasing his versatility and mastery of both wind band and symphony orchestra arrangements. Sousa's legacy as a trombonist, composer, and conductor continues to inspire, making him one of the most renowned figures in American music history.
